摘要
Photo-assisted lithium-oxygen (Li-O-2) batteries have been developed as a new system to reduce a large overpotential in the Li-O-2 batteries. However, constructing an optimized photocatalyst is still a challenge to achieve broad light absorption and a low recombined rate of photoexcited electrons and holes. Herein, oxygen vacancy-rich molybdenum trioxide (MoO3-x) nanorods are employed as photocatalysts to accelerate kinetics of cathode reactions in the photo-assisted Li-O-2 batteries. Oxygen vacancies on the MoO3-x nanorods can not only increase light-harvesting capability but also improve electrochemical activity for the cathode reactions. Under illumination, the photoexcited electrons and holes are effectively separated on the MoO3-x nanorods. During discharging, activated O-2 is reduced to Li2O2 by the photoexcited electrons from the MoO3-x nanorods. The photoexcited holes can promote the decomposition of Li2O2 during subsequent charging. Accordingly, the photo-assisted Li-O-2 batteries with the MoO3-x nanorods deliver an ultralow overpotential of 0.22 V, considerable rate capability, and good reversibility. We think that this work could give a reference for the exploitation and application of the photocatalysts in the photo-assisted Li-O-2 batteries.
